About AI results
- When it’s used. AI is used only when we don’t have a curated entry yet, or to enhance it with a definition/audio/two-image combo.
 - Labeling. AI-generated parts are clearly labeled “AI” in the panel.
 - Quality & limits. While helpful, AI can make mistakes or be incomplete — especially with proper nouns or new slang.
 - Feedback. Use “Report” in the panel to flag an issue; we review and improve coverage continuously.

FAQ & Troubleshooting
The panel doesn’t appear when I click a word.
Check the basics first:
- Make sure the extension is installed and enabled.
 - Refresh the page; some sites block overlays until reload.
 - Try clicking a plain word (not a link, button, or inside an input field).
 - Some sites prevent overlays (heavy iframes, canvas apps). Try another site to confirm it’s working.
 - If you run ad/privacy blockers, allowlist visuallexicon.org and the extension.
 
The panel opens but nothing loads (spinner forever).
- Confirm you’re signed in (look for the account avatar or “Sign in” prompt).
 - Check your connection or VPN; strict networks can block requests.
 - Disable extensions that rewrite pages (content filters, script blockers) and try again.
 - Hard refresh the page (Windows: Ctrl+F5, macOS: Cmd+Shift+R).

Audio won’t play.
- Browsers may block autoplay with sound. Click the play icon in the panel to allow audio.
 - Check system volume and that the tab isn’t muted.
 - If it’s still silent, try another word; some entries may not have audio for all locales yet.
 
Images look blurry or fail to load.
- Give it a second on slow connections—images load progressively.
 - If you’re zoomed in heavily, try 100% zoom to compare.
 - Corporate proxies/content filters can compress or block images. Try a different network or allowlist our domain.
 - Use “Report” in the panel if a specific image is broken or irrelevant.
 
“Sign in” loop / the panel keeps asking me to log in.
- Ensure you’re using the same browser profile you used to sign in.
 - Allow cookies for visuallexicon.org. Blocking third-party cookies can prevent session restore.
 - Close all tabs, quit the browser completely, reopen, and try again.
